The Ultimate Wedding Revenge

A hotel owner saves the best venue for her best friend's wedding. Instead of gratitude, the bridezilla demands free upgrades, accuses her of scamming, and even slaps her! Furious, the owner cancels the booking on the spot. Watch the toxic bride suffer a humiliating disaster in a cheap diner while the owner's luxury hotel business booms!
